Аутентифицировать пользователя, используя имя папки (домен)

Я потерял свой пароль и логин для Ubuntu и теперь пытаюсь его сбросить. Я использую локальную машину с Ubuntu 18.04. Я нашел правильный путь (некоторое руководство), используя такую ​​команду из безопасного режима:

passwd username

Но мой логин использует домен в нем:

MYDOMAIN\mikhail

и я могу проверить это с помощью ls в каталоге home:

home
 |- baseuser
 |- MYDOMAIN
   | - mikhail
   | - anotheruser

Это означает, что у меня есть каталог MYDOMAIN в домашнем каталоге и некоторые пользователи в нем. Один из них - мой: mikhail. Я попробовал эту команду:

passwd MYDOMAIN\mikhail

И получил ошибку:

такого пользователя нет.

Я перепробовал все возможные случаи:

passwd mikhail
passwd MYDOMAIN\\mikhail
passwd MYDOMAIN/mikhail
passwd MYDOMAIN//mikhail
passwd MYDOMAIN.mikhail
passwd MYDOMAIN@mikhail

Как правильно написать это?

1
задан 28 June 2019 в 19:45

1 ответ

Ваша система установлена ​​с активным доменом (AD). Это означает, что вам нужно сбросить пароль на сервере Windows NT.

Вам нужна команда smbpassword , чтобы изменить ее, НО это зависит от настроек безопасности на сервере домена (т. Е. Windows NT), если вам разрешено использовать этот метод.

smbpasswd -U {USER} -r {IP_ADDRESS_DOMAIN_SERVER}

   -r remote machine name
       This option allows a user to specify what machine they wish to
       change their password on. Without this parameter smbpasswd defaults
       to the local host. The remote machine name is the NetBIOS name of
       the SMB/CIFS server to contact to attempt the password change. This
       name is resolved into an IP address using the standard name
       resolution mechanism in all programs of the Samba suite. See the -R
       name resolve order parameter for details on changing this resolving
       mechanism.

       The username whose password is changed is that of the current UNIX
       logged on user. See the -U username parameter for details on
       changing the password for a different username.

   -U username
       This option may only be used in conjunction with the -r option.
       When changing a password on a remote machine it allows the user to
       specify the user name on that machine whose password will be
       changed. It is present to allow users who have different user names
       on different systems to change these passwords.

Если вы получили NT_STATUS_ACCESS_DENIED, вам нужно спросить своего администратора Windows.

0
ответ дан 28 June 2019 в 19:45

Другие вопросы по тегам:

Похожие вопросы: